VTV.vn - The amended Penal Code has gone some way in further ensuring human rights in Vietnam, according to Vietnamese and international experts at the 11th Legal partner Forum on Tuesday in Hanoi.

The event was organised by the Ministry of Justice and UN Development Programme in Vietnam. The amended Penal Code was passed on Nov 27th and it removes death penalty for 7 crimes.

According to participants, it is a step forwards the implementation of human rights provisions outlined in 2013 Constitution as well as some UN recommendations for Vietnam on reducing death sentences. The Universal Periodic Review is a mechanism of the UN Human Rights Council to improve the human rights of UN member states.
